OBF-file
Jump to navigation
Jump to search
Diese Datei definiert die Ziele für die Optimierung. Jede Zeile entspricht einer Zielfunktion.
Die Datei muss den gleichen Namen wie der BlueM-Datensatz haben, aber mit der Endung .ZIE, und muss sich im BlueM-Arbeitsverzeichnis befinden.
Beispielhafte ZIE-Datei für eine Autokalibrierung mit 3 Zielfunktionen:
*Optimierungsziele *================= * *|---------------|---------|-------|----------|---------|--------------|--------------------|---------------------------| *| Bezeichnung | ZielTyp | Datei | SimGröße | ZielFkt | EvalZeitraum | Zielwert ODER Zielreihe | *| | | | | | Start | Ende | WertTyp | ZielWert | ZielGröße | Datei | *|---------------|---------|-------|----------|---------|-------|------|---------|----------|-----------|---------------| | QSpitze | Wert | WEL | S100_1ZU | Diff | | | MaxWert | 50 | | | | SumFehlQ | Reihe | WEL | S100_1ZU | AbQuad | | | | | | Zeitreihe.zre | | Volumenfehler | Reihe | WEL | S100_1ZU | Volf | | | | | S100_ZU | Zeitreihe.wel | *|---------------|---------|-------|----------|---------|-------|------|---------|----------|-----------|---------------|
Die 2 Spalten "EvalZeitraum" sind noch nicht implementiert! (Bug 199)
Spaltenbeschreibung
Bezeichnung Bezeichnung des Optimierungsziels (beliebig) ZielTyp Wert
: Es handelt sich um einen einzelnen ZielwertReihe
: Es handelt sich um eine Zielreihe
Datei Die Ergebnisdatei, aus der das Simulationsergebnis ausgelesen werden soll [WEL, BIL, PRB(Bug 220)]SimGröße Die Simulationsgröße, auf dessen Basis der Qualitätswert berechnet werden soll ZielFkt Gibt an welche Zielfunktion verwendet werden soll. AbQuad
: Abweichung der FehlerquadrateDiff
: DifferenznÜber
: Relative Anzahl der Zeitschritte mit Überschreitung des Zielwerts/der Zielreihe (in Prozent)sÜber
: Summe der Überschreitungen des Zielwerts/der ZielreihenUnter
: Relative Anzahl der Zeitschritte mit Unterschreitung des Zielwerts/der Zielreihe (in Prozent)sUnter
: Summe der Unterschreitungen des Zielwerts/der ZielreiheVolf
: Volumenfehler (nur bei Zielreihen möglich)IHA
: Indicators of Hydrologic Alteration
EvalZeitraum
(optional)
noch nicht implementiert! (Bug 199)Bestimmt den Zeitraum, für den die Zielfunktion ausgewertet werden soll.
Format:
dd.mm.yyyy hh:mm
Wenn nicht angegeben, wird der Simulationszeitraum verwendet.WertTyp
(nur bei Zielwerten)Gibt an wie der Wert, der mit dem Zielwert verglichen werden soll, aus dem Simulationsergebnis berechnet werden soll. MaxWert
: Maximaler Wert des SimulationsergebnissesMinWert
: Minimaler Wert des SimulationsergebnissesAverage
: Durchschnittlicher Wert des SimulationsergebnissesAnfWert
: Der erste wert des SimulationsergebnissesEndWert
: Der letzte Wert des Simulationsergebnisses
Zielwert
(nur bei Zielwerten)Der zu vergleichende Zielwert ZielGröße
(nur bei Zielreihen und .wel als Zieldatei)Gibt an welche Spalte der .wel Zieldatei zum Vergleich herangezogen werden soll. Datei
(nur bei Zielreihen)Der Dateiname der Zielreihe (.zre oder .wel)
Achtung: Die Zeitschrittweite der Zielreihe muss mit dem Zeitschritt der Simulation übereinstimmen! (siehe Bug 218)
Die Breite der Spalten darf bei Bedarf angepasst werden, nur alle "|"-Zeichen müssen erhalten bleiben!
Ein "*
" am Anfang einer Zeile führt dazu, dass die Zeile ignoriert wird.